The Free of Bruges

anonymous · 1663 · striking (metalworking); copper (metal)

From the collection of Rijksmuseum, Amsterdam. Free to download, adapt and use — no permission needed.

About this work

Copper medal. Obverse: crowned coat of arms, draped with the Order of the Golden Fleece within a laurel wreath. Reverse: coat of arms under three oak branches, flanked by two wild men, the left one carrying a club over his shoulder, between the date and an inscription.
